Seminar "Plastics recycling in Saxony"

On May 24, 2022, from 9: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. in Dresden, the 31st edition of the event series is to be held again at the Leibniz Institute for Polymer Research (IPF).


The Interessengemeinschaft Kunststoffrecyclinginitiative Sachsen e.V. (IG KURIS) invites to the seminar, which, according to the organizers, will be held hybrid as in 2021. Two of the speakers will reportedly give their presentations online and interested parties can also participate in the event virtually. According to the program, the seminar will start at 9:00 a.m. with a welcome by Brigitte Voit of the Leibniz Institute of Polymer Research Dresden e.V.. This will be followed by a presentation on the plastics strategy of the Free State of Saxony by Erik Nowak, officer for recycling management at the Saxon State Ministry for Climate Protection, Energy, Environment and Agriculture, and a talk by Dr. Thomas Probst of the Bundesverband Sekundärrohstoffe und Entsorgung e.V. (Bonn) on the association's view of chemical recycling. Thomas Fischer of Deutsche Umwelthilfe e.V. (Berlin) will give an online presentation starting at 10:30 a.m. on "Plastics: A Problem? Ways to deal with them properly". According to the agenda, the event will continue after the lunch break with a situation report on the state of chemical recycling by Felix Dobritz from the Technical University of Dresden. Annerose Hüttl from the Plastics Center in Leipzig and Ansgar Schonlau from MAAG GmbH (Ense) will then report on how the production of lightweight components from foamed recycled material works and how sustainable material flows can be formed with mono-packaging. Starting at 2:30 p.m., an online presentation is planned by Johannes Walter from the Ministry of Agriculture, Environment and Climate Protection of the State of Brandenburg. He will present the results from the special working group of the Conference of Environment Ministers on "Strengthening the use of recycled plastics". Frank Gerber of bage plastics Deutschland GmbH (Großschirma) will then speak on the recycling of plastics from post-consumer electrical appliances. According to the program, the event will conclude with a presentation on "Accompanying brand-name manufacturers on their way to the circular economy" by Roman Maletz of HolyPoly GmbH (Dresden). According to the organizers, the "Plastics Recycling in Saxony" seminar has been characterized by its "informal" atmosphere and the opportunity for in-depth discussion since the series of events began in 1992.
